
MATLAB Simulink机械臂控制仿真教程

本资源文件是一个关于如何使用MATLAB和其集成环境Simulink进行机械臂控制仿真的教程或案例集。MATLAB(Matrix Laboratory的缩写)是由MathWorks公司开发的一款高级数值计算语言和交互式环境,广泛应用于工程计算、数据分析、算法开发等领域。Simulink是MATLAB的一个附加产品,它提供了一个可视化的多域仿真和基于模型的设计环境,用于模拟和嵌入式系统以及多域动态和嵌入式系统。
在标题中提到的“MATLAB机械臂简单控制仿真(Simulink篇-总)”表明该资源集合专注于通过Simulink来实现机械臂的模拟控制,特别是简单控制系统的仿真。Simulink允许工程师构建基于块图的系统模型,来模拟控制算法和机械系统。
描述部分提到“MATLAB下机器人可视化与控制---simulink篇中的简单例子”,这表示资源中包含了具体的实例教程,用于展示如何在MATLAB环境下通过Simulink来实现机器人模型的可视化和控制。这可能涉及到了Simulink中预定义轨迹的运动仿真,也就是说,用户可以设置机械臂沿着特定路径移动的仿真,并通过Simulink的图形化界面观察到其运动轨迹。此外,还可能包括了Slider Gain控制的运动,这通常指的是通过滑动条调整控制参数,以观察机械臂的响应变化。
“用GUI控制的关节代码”意味着在Simulink模型中可能有一个图形用户界面(Graphical User Interface,GUI),用来调整和控制机械臂的关节运动。在GUI中,用户可以通过按键、滑动条或其他控件与机械臂模型交互,这样可以更直观地进行控制参数的设置和实时控制。
在标签中指出了“MATLAB Simulink”,这标明了资源的两个核心要素:MATLAB软件和Simulink模块。对于想要学习机械臂控制、机器人学、动态系统仿真等领域的研究者和工程师来说,这个资源提供了一个很好的实践平台。
由于压缩文件中并未提供具体的文件列表,仅提供了"新建文件夹 (3)"的说明,我们无法了解该压缩包内具体的文件内容。但是,可以推测该压缩包至少包含了一些Simulink模型文件(通常以.slx为扩展名),可能还有相应的MATLAB脚本文件(通常以.m为扩展名),以及可能存在的文档说明、示例代码等资源。
在使用这些资源时,用户需要有MATLAB和Simulink的环境。建议用户先阅读相关文档,了解Simulink的工作原理以及如何构建模型。接着,用户可以通过修改Simulink模型中的参数,包括轨迹参数、控制增益等,来观察机械臂运动的变化,从而加深对机器人控制理论和仿真工具的理解。通过实际操作,用户可以更加直观地理解控制系统设计和动态行为分析的重要性。
对于希望深入学习的用户而言,可以在Simulink模型的基础上加入更复杂的控制算法,例如PID控制、模糊逻辑控制或者神经网络控制等,进一步提升对控制理论和实践的掌握。同时,也可以结合MATLAB的其他工具箱,如Robust Control Toolbox、Control System Toolbox等,来进一步提高控制系统的鲁棒性和性能。
相关推荐








weixin_42680594
- 粉丝: 27
最新资源
- 深入解析J2EE中文版教程
- C语言编写电梯模拟程序的免费下载
- 掌握C#与.NET:揭秘顶级面试题
- Java核心技术要点学习笔记总结
- Linux环境下的高效多线程下载实现
- 无广告体验QQ:Miranda IM v0.6.8源代码带QQ插件
- 探索微软C编程精粹的深度学习资源
- C#实现的在线聊天室教程与源代码
- C#本地视频工具优化版:CaptureVideo2003
- CodeHaggis Eclipse 插件深度解析
- 探索高效JavaScript树形控件:dhtmlxgrid与xtree117
- JDOM在Java中操作XML的创建与修改实例演示
- 30套经典网页设计模板免费下载
- eWebEditor:免费的.net在线HTML编辑器使用指南
- 深度解析php168整站系统4.0:便捷易用的CMS
- C/C++嵌入式系统编程经典教程下载
- ASP.NET C#开发的Windows图片管理系统
- Middlegen-Hibernate-r5压缩包内容概览
- 仓库管理系统源代码的解析与应用
- 解析GB1526-89:软件开发流程图的国家标准
- Hibernate入门新手指南及源代码解析
- 深入学习Ajax:三个实用的入门实例
- 新手易学的Python编程入门教程
- JSTL技术教程:电子书与课件下载资源